D3 Point Maps from Pandas DataFrames
quickD3map allows you to rapidly generate D3.js maps from data from within the pandas/ipython ecosystem by converting Latitude/Longitude Data in to points Note: this is an experimental repo and not ready for use. With that said, basic maps can be generated and below are a few examples of how they are made.
To make the following interactive map:
Install and Use from the Examples Directory
import pandas as pd
from quickD3map import PointMap
#load data and plot
stations = pd.read_csv('data/weatherstations.csv')
#make a PointMap object
pm = PointMap(stations, columns = ['LAT','LON','ELEV'])
#display or write your map to file
pm.display_map()
pm.create_map(path="map.html")
###Project Goals The goal of this project is rather limited in scope:
- be able to rapidly plot location data from Pandas dataframes
- be able to color by another column
- be able to scale by another column
- be able to plot connections between plots
I intend to include several map templates (geojson files) and will try to figure out a template style that can provide the ability to include maps of many types.
